Ticket: Incremental rebuild drift on Bramblepress

The staging and production builders for the Bramblepress site have diverged: staging rebuilds only changed pages, while production still performs full rebuilds, inflating deploy times by roughly eight minutes. Root cause is a manual edit made during the Hollowmere outage that was never backported. The intended canonical settings, to be applied to both environments, are below.

settings of tagef-bawif:
DRUIX_HOST=druix.zemvarlabs.internal
DRUIX_PORT=8000

Hey Priya — handing off the Lumengate token bug before I'm out. Sessions refreshed via the Kestrelwing sidecar sometimes reuse the old signing window, so a stale token stays valid about 90 seconds past expiry. I've patched the clock-skew check in staging; prod still runs the old build. For the security review, the relevant service settings are pasted below.

config for bagep-kageg:
ULADOR_LOG_LEVEL=warn
ULADOR_METRICS_HOST=metrics.ulador.tolvaqcorp.corp
ULADOR_POOL_SIZE=32

**Step 4: Configure the receipt mailer**

The Almsgate donation-receipt mailer runs as a sidecar on the billing pod. Copy env.sample to .env, set MAILER_REGION=east and RECEIPT_TEMPLATE=v3. Do not enable sandbox mode in production — receipts won't send. The mailer authenticates to the relay with a signing secret. Add the following line to the .env file before starting the service.

secret setting of bajeg-yahog: LEDGER_TOKEN20=f833f3e2e6625ec0dee3

**Q: How do I check results from the Fenwick ticket-pricing experiment?**

Short version: the dashboard under Experiments → Pricing shows lift per cohort, refreshed hourly. If the dashboard asks you to re-authenticate (it does this weekly, annoyingly), use the shared experiment account, whose recovery passphrase is kept right below for the sync notes.

strongbox words: norwyn-wenael-aldvan-aldiel-wendor-holael